Church Bells in the Valley by Roselyn Ederer
Church Bells in the Valley, by Roselynn Ederer, reviewed by Kelly Swartz,
Hoyt Library Local History & Genealogy Collection
(Thomastown Publishing Co., 2006, 314 pages, $21.95)
Roselynn Ederer has done it again, with Book 7 of the “Building a Michigan Lumber Town” series of books highlighting the history of the Saginaw Valley. This volume provides a well-documented history of the religious denominations throughout Saginaw County since the 1800’s. Photographs of churches, miscellaneous church groups and Sunday school classroom photographs are scattered throughout nine chapters of cited text. This is a great resource for both serious researchers and those just wanting to reminisce about Saginaw’s religious past.
